What do expats in Andros Island appreciate most about the local culture?
We asked expats and digital nomads what they appreciate the most about the local culture in Andros Island. They wrote...
"Expats in Andros Island appreciate the warm and friendly nature of the locals. They love the laid-back lifestyle and the slower pace of life that allows them to relax and enjoy their surroundings. The rich cultural heritage, which includes traditional music, dance, and festivals, is also highly appreciated. Expats enjoy the fresh seafood and local cuisine, which is a significant part of the island's culture. They also value the strong sense of community and the way locals come together to help each other. The beautiful natural environment, with its pristine beaches and clear waters, is another aspect of the local culture that expats greatly appreciate," said another expat in Andros Island, Bahamas.
